4Pcs/Set Engine Motor Front Center Trans Mount for Subaru Legacy Outback 2.5L 2010-2012 41022AJ030 41022AJ000 41022AJ070

4Pcs/Set Engine Motor Front Center Trans Mount for Subaru Legacy Outback 2.5L 2010-2012 41022AJ030 41022AJ000 41022AJ070
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005005274699402
$88.24
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ed